The "War for Emperium" is something I never really understood, but did take part in. There are several (About 5 or 6) big hugely labyrinth link castles scattered around, currently filled with HUGE monsters that would take a huge party to clear out - However they can be taken over by a guild. (Hahah guildwars rofl. They're like a glorified party, with with an icon) And then can be taken over by enemy guilds in a short timeslot twice a day.

As for zombies - I remember there was a player even where the top right of pronterra (Where the church is) was swamped by lots and lots of zombies and higher-level ones too. It was kinda fun to see someone respawn and then get bludgened to death seconds later by a rogue mob.
